Suno

Suno has established itself as the best-known benchmark in the creation of complete songs using AI. It allows you to generate lyrics, music, and vocals, achieving natural results in different languages. Its system is designed for users who want agility, with two modes (one simple and one advanced for greater creative control over genres and lyrical style). However, it requires registration and has a daily generation limit. Among its advantages is the ability to customize the song from the prompt and control aspects such as rhythm, emotions, and vocals. Additionally, the community can serve as inspiration, and all compositions can be downloaded or shared on social media.

rifusion

rifusion It also uses AI to create songs from descriptive texts or prompts. It stands out for its quick mode and advanced tools for adding genres or customizing lyrics. The free version allows for unlimited experimentation, albeit with some technical restrictions. It's a popular option for converting lyrics to audio, even for creating music videos with a single click. You can adjust the length of each word and easily export the content to platforms like TikTok or share via links.

Another platform that has generated a lot of interest is Udio. Its approach divides creation into three simple steps: defining style, lyrics, and vibe. The system allows you to control the speed, energy, and level of chaos of your composition thanks to configurable presets. You can write the lyrics manually or let the AI take care of it. Udio is powered by leading AI experts, which translates into an experience tailored for any user, without requiring musical knowledge.

MusicGPT

MusicGPT offers an intuitive text-only music generation solution: Describe the sound you have in mind (instruments, structure, genre, atmosphere), and it will produce the song in just a few minutes. It's ideal for both inspiration seekers and content creators, with fast results and the option to generate sound effects, spoken-word clips, and automatic lyrics. It has a community library and includes features for those with no musical experience.

soundraw

Soundraw stands out for its customization possibilities and variety of genres: You can choose everything from genre and instruments to energy level and length. It allows you to listen to and edit your created music, although downloads are limited to subscribers. It's very easy to control the song structure and adjust intros, choruses, and endings. It also features integration with video editors and plugins for Chrome and Premiere Pro.

boomy

Boomy is perfect for those who want speed and monetization: Generates original songs in seconds, with style filters and templates. It offers the ability to export your music to Spotify, YouTube, and other platforms, allowing you to earn revenue from streams. Every time you create music, the AI learns about your tastes, adapting new suggestions. You can record or upload vocals and modify the structure of your songs before publishing them.

FlexClip AI Music Generator

FlexClip focuses on ease of use and integration with video projects: In just three steps, you can upload reference tracks and, optionally, lyrics to create your own compositions in genres like pop, rock, classical, or jazz. Its voice cloning feature adds customization and is ideal for creating background music tailored to videos. The entire generation process is guided and suitable for both beginners and more experienced producers.

Hydra II

Hydra II, from Rightsify, is an advanced music model that leverages over a million songs to generate highly customizable royalty-free music. It's designed for businesses, artists, and creators looking for unique commercial music. It supports over 800 instruments and 50 languages, with several subscription plans, including a free one. It allows you to create instrumental music and sound effects, making editing easier and avoiding issues with using generated voices.

VAT

AIVA is one of the most established and appreciated AI music generators for creating soundtracks: You can choose from over 250 musical styles, customize tracks, and edit any fragment to achieve the desired sound. It's especially valued for its advanced mode, which gives demanding users full control, and its free version allows you to create and download multiple tracks per month in MP3 or MIDI. AIVA is capable of producing everything from orchestral music to modern songs, and also allows you to modify existing songs.

loudly

Loudly stands out for its powerful sample library and focus on sound quality: You can define musical formulas, and the AI generates several unique tracks for you to choose the one that best suits you. It offers automatic recommendations based on the scene, allowing you to mix genres and emotions. It offers free and paid plans, with the ability to save and reuse your favorite "formulas." Its algorithm combines expert techniques and machine learning, achieving rich results.

soundful

Soundful is the choice for those who need completely royalty-free background music for videos, podcasts, or events: After selecting a genre and adjusting a few parameters, you can generate new, unique tracks in seconds. It has over 50 templates and is guaranteed to produce a fresh result, as its AI is trained note by note alongside professional producers. Plus, you can save your tracks, manage them, and adapt them to the requirements of platforms like YouTube or TikTok.

These Lyrics Do Not Exist, LyricStudio and DeepBeat

For those seeking inspiration exclusively in lyrics, there are specialized options: 'These Lyrics Do Not Exist' generates complete lyrics based on themes, genres, and emotions. 'LyricStudio' acts as an assistant, helping complete or improve draft lyrics. 'DeepBeat' focuses on rap lyrics, offering rhymes and automatic suggestions, and even allowing verse generation based on context. These lyrics are ideal for unblocking creative blocks and are free to use or with limited results.

LALAL.AI

LALAL.AI isn't a music generator as such, but it is the best option for separating vocals and instrumentals from any audio or video file: Upload your tracks and download individual versions, ideal for creators who want to remix or practice over instrumental beats. The tool supports bulk file uploads and splitting is fast and accurate, with both free and paid options.

Other innovative tools

  • BandLab Songstarter: Song suggestions based on genre and lyrics, with advanced editing options in the paid version.
  • Soundverse: Custom music generation from prompts, instrument tuning, mood, and purpose, plus advanced editing (stretching, vocal recording, auto-completion, etc.).
  • MusicGen: Open-source model available at Hugging Face, ideal for experimenting with small musical ideas directly from the web, although the quality still has room for improvement.
  • Amadeus Code: iOS app based on the chord progression of famous songs to create custom compositions in minutes, exportable in audio and MIDI.
  • WavTool: AI-powered online DAW that suggests chords, melodies, and changes, with recording and mixing capabilities right in the browser.
  • Ecrett Music: A simple, visual generator that lets you select the scene, mood, and style to create different tracks every time, with favorites management and download history.

How do these tools work?

All of these platforms share a common principle: they use artificial intelligence to analyze thousands of musical data points and predict patterns, structures, and styles. Depending on the tool, you can:

  • Describe the song (theme, style, instruments, emotion, duration) in a text box or via interactive menus.
  • Choosing letters automatically generated or customize your own verses.
  • Customize details such as tempo, tonality, instrumentation, energy or voice.
  • Edit, mix and export in audio or video format, with options for sharing on networks and streaming platforms.
